Wellness Resort and Spa Architecture Design is a specialized field that focuses on creating spaces that promote relaxation, rejuvenation, and overall well-being. This type of design is not just about aesthetics, but also about functionality and sustainability. Architects and designers who specialize in this field must have a deep understanding of the needs of the users, as well as the principles of biophilia and sustainable design. One of the key aspects of Wellness Resort and Spa Architecture Design is the incorporation of natural elements into the built environment. This can include features such as green roofs, living walls, and water features, which not only enhance the aesthetic appeal of the space but also have a positive impact on the physical and mental health of the occupants. The use of natural materials, such as wood and stone, is also common in this type of design. Another important aspect of Wellness Resort and Spa Architecture Design is the creation of spaces that are functional and efficient. This includes the use of energy-efficient systems and the incorporation of eco-friendly features, such as solar panels and rainwater harvesting systems. The design must also take into consideration the local climate and the surrounding landscape, in order to create a space that is comfortable and inviting. In addition to the physical design of the space, Wellness Resort and Spa Architecture Design also involves the creation of programs and activities that promote health and well-being. This can include yoga and meditation classes, healthy eating options, and spa treatments that use natural and organic products. Overall, Wellness Resort and Spa Architecture Design is a holistic approach to creating spaces that promote health and well-being. It involves a deep understanding of the needs of the users, as well as the principles of biophilia and sustainable design. By incorporating natural elements, creating functional and efficient spaces, and offering programs and activities that promote health, Wellness Resort and Spa Architecture Design creates a space that is both beautiful and beneficial to the occupants.

Wellness resort and spa architecture design is an approach to designing buildings and spaces that prioritize the physical and mental health of the occupants. It is based on the principles of biophilia, which is the belief that humans have an innate connection to nature, and that incorporating natural elements into the built environment can have positive impacts on well-being. The design of wellness resorts and spas should take into account the needs of guests and staff, the local climate, and the surrounding landscape in order to create a pleasant and calming atmosphere.

Wellness Resort And Spa Architecture Design is a specialized process within the design sector which involves the planning, designing and construction of resorts and spas with a focus on the health and well-being of the guests. It requires a deep understanding of the needs of the user, with architectural principles and strategies applied to the design in order to create an environment that is conducive for relaxation and rejuvenation. The design should take into consideration the overall aesthetic and functional elements, such as landscape design, maximum daylight exposure, natural ventilation, energy efficiency, efficient use of materials, and the incorporation of eco-friendly features. These aspects, along with the architectural elements form a holistic approach to create a space that offers exclusive experiences and promotes a healthful lifestyle.
